Inscription.
St. John Catholic Church and Parish Hall has been placed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1979 by the United States Department of the Interior
 
Erected 2023 by William G. Pomeroy Foundation. (Marker Number 527.)
 
Topics and series. This historical marker is listed in this topic list: Religion & Religious Structures. In addition, it is included in the National Register of Historic Places (NRHP), and the William G. Pomeroy Foundation series lists. A significant historical year for this entry is 1979.
 
Location. 40° 30.945′ N, 84° 8.895′ W. Marker is in Fryburg, Ohio, in Auglaize County. It is in Pusheta Township. It is on Van Buren Street south of Schemel Street, on the left when traveling north.
